- Employee [0..1] Employee information
- ContractReference [0..1] Is a reference to a contract
- AbsenceType [0..1] This describes the type of absence a worker is reporting in a time and attendance collection process
- OverTimeIndicator [0..1] This is used to identify work subject to overtime processing.
- ScheduleType [0..1] ScheduleType is a code or identifier that describes the specific schedule and can be used in a variety of contexts. When used in the context of employee, ScheduleType refers to the specific schedule for the employee or worker. When used in the context of a Schedule, ScheduleType indicates whether the Schedule is a demand schedule from a customer or a supply schedule from a supplier. Valid values for this context are: “Demand”, “Supplier”
- WageType [0..1] This is a code or identifier that describes the specific type a wage an employee or worker is paid. Examples include: Exempt from Overtime, Non-Exempt from Overtime
- WageGroupCode [0..1] This is used to classify an employee’s wage
- WorkShiftID [0..1] This is the Employee Shift Identifier. ShiftId describes the regular or standard authorized work time for the employee
- WorkLocation [0..1] Location where work is assigned or reported to be performed.
- WorkTimePeriod [0..1] This is the time of a business reporting period
- GLEntityID [0..1] A G/L entity is the smallest organizational unit for which individual financial statements must be drawn up according to relevant commercial law. It is normally the primary balancing segment of the GL Account structure. Typically, this is the owning entity for the transaction. Synonyms are Business Unit, Fund, G/L Company, Joint Venture, Non-Profit Association Name
